- The boldly reimagined life of a brave young woman who was the basis for a character in the Odyssey.
- Graves plays out his radical contention that the Odyssey was written by a young woman.

Notă biografică
Robert Graves was born in 1895 in Wimbledon. He went from school to the First World War, where he became a captain in the Royal Welch Fusiliers and was seriously wounded at the Battle of the Somme. He wrote his autobiography, Goodbye to All That, in 1929, and it was soon established as a modern classic. He died on 7 December 1985 in Majorca, his home since 1929.
